13 <br />EXTERIOR SIGNAGE FABRICATION SPECIFICATIONS <br />C. Equal or better equipment or method may be recommended, but <br />fabricator will be required to provide full documentation, upon <br />request, establishing such a substitution’s equality or superiority <br />as measured in compliance with the visual design intent, cost, <br />ease of maintenance, and performance. <br />D. The Owner’s Representative and Designer’s decision of approval <br />or disapproval of a proposed substitution shall be fi nal. <br />2.4 FABRICATION <br />A. Details on Design Intent Drawings indicate a design approach for <br />sign structure but do not include all fabrication details required <br />for the complete structural integrity of the signs, including <br />consideration for static, dynamic and erection loads during <br />handling, erecting, and service at the installed locations. <br />B. General: <br />1. It is intended that the workmanship be of the highest quality <br />obtainable by the respective trades and crafts experienced <br />in the fabrication of architectural signs. <br />2. Fabricate signage such that major components of the sign <br />can be removed and replaced with similar components. <br />Incorporate this changeability such that it does not promote <br />vandalism but can be done by a qualifi ed maintenance crew. <br />3. Within fabrication tolerances, allow for expansion and <br />contraction of materials due to temperature changes as <br />appropriate to the project location. <br />C. Fonts/Typefaces: <br />1. All tactile and braille characters must meet current ADA <br />code requirements. <br />2. Letter height/cap height is based upon the height of the <br />capital letter “E” or any capital character that has a fl at top <br />and base. <br />3. Under no circumstances are typefaces to be electronically <br />distorted (“squeezed” or “extended”) for purposes of fi tting <br />to the specifi ed sign. This includes (but is not limited to) <br />stretching, squeezing, tilting, outlining, or shadowing. <br />4. Ligatures are to be turned off. <br />5. Apostrophes and quotation marks are to be used, not <br />footmarks and inches. Note there is a difference in <br />most fonts. <br />6. Fabricator to reference spacing and layout examples within <br />the Design Intent Drawing package. <br />7. Fabricator is responsible for correcting any typesetting errors <br />that may be necessary. <br />D. Sign Faces: <br />1. Sign faces to be fabricated using aluminum of varying <br />thicknesses, as specifi ed on Design Intent Drawings, with a <br />minimum thickness of .125" unless otherwise noted. <br />2. Any sign faces smaller than 8' by 20' are to be fabricated <br />from 1 piece of seamless material. <br />3. Any sign faces larger than 8' by 20' are to follow Welded <br />Joint specifi cations. Joints must be fi lled and ground <br />smooth so there is no visible seam. <br />4. Non-illuminated sign faces are to have lettering and <br />graphics created as surface-applied vinyl typography unless <br />otherwise noted in the Design Intent Drawings. <br />5. Acrylic faces are to be of suffi cient thickness to preclude <br />bowing or distortion within frames. <br />E. Push-through copy: <br />1. Routed push-through copy from a single sheet of acrylic. <br />Letters and shapes that are routed out and bonded to a <br />separate acrylic sheet are not acceptable. <br />2. Exposed acrylic edges are to be fi nished such that no saw <br />marks are visible. <br />3. Acrylic to have a minimum thickness of 3/8". <br />4. Acrylic to be pushed through fl ush evenly to 3/32" unless <br />otherwise noted on design drawing. <br />5. Acrylic is to be attached to the interior of the sign using <br />mechanical fasteners and silicon. <br />6. All letter knock-outs (interior of letter forms) are to be stud <br />mounted through the acrylic. <br />7. Acceptable spacing between the push-through acrylic and <br />the cutout aluminum is 1/32" for copy 12" or smaller. Copy <br />larger than 12" may have alternate spacing to allow for the <br />change in material expansion. <br />8. The edges and corners of routed letterforms shall be sharp <br />and true. Letterforms with nicked, cut, ragged, rounded <br />(positive or negative) corners, and similar disfi gurements will <br />not be acceptable. <br />F. Fasteners: <br />1. Conceal all fasteners except for access panels or where <br />approved otherwise by Owner’s Representative and <br />Designer. Access panel fasteners are to be stainless steel, <br />tamper resistant, counter-sunk fl ush screws, painted to <br />match adjacent fi nish. <br />2. All hardware and fasteners within reach shall be <br />vandal resistant. <br />3. To prevent electrolysis, separate all ferrous and non-ferrous <br />materials with a non-conductive gasket or barrier and utilize <br />stainless steel fasteners as required. <br />4. Pop rivets are not acceptable on the exterior of the <br />sign cabinet. <br />G. Welded joints: <br />1. Exposed welded joints must be fi lled and ground smooth so <br />there is no seam visible when painted. <br />2. Dimensional and structural welding defects will not be <br />accepted, including but not limited to: poor weld contours, <br />including excessive bead convexity and reinforcement, <br />and considerable concavity or undersized welds; cracks; <br />undercutting; porosity; incomplete fusion; inadequate <br />penetration; spatter; and non-metallic inclusions. <br />3. Welding is to be performed by AWS (or similar) certifi ed <br />personnel, following AWS Standard Welding Procedure <br />Specifi cations (SWPSs) for steel, aluminum, and stainless <br />steel as appropriate. <br />H. Non-welded joints: <br />1. Signs must have a tight, hairline-type appearance, without <br />gaps. Provide suffi cient fastenings to preclude looseness, <br />racking, or similar movement. <br />2. Visible metal joints must adhere to a fi t tolerance of .01". <br />I. Channel letters: <br />1. Raceways are not acceptable unless specifi cally noted on <br />the Design Intent Drawing or if approved by the Owner. <br />a. Approved raceways must be painted the same color as <br />the wall on which the raceway will be mounted. <br />2. Acrylic must fi t snuggly into the letter return. <br />3. Returns on Channel letters two feet or greater in height shall <br />be fabricated with a minimum of .080" thick aluminum. <br />4. Returns on Channel letters under two feet in height shall be <br />a minimum of .063" aluminum. <br />5. Jewel trim is not acceptable, unless specifi cally called out in <br />the Design Intent Drawings. <br />6. Non-illuminated Channel Letters: <br />a. Non-illuminated faces must be a minimum of .125" <br />thick aluminum. <br />7. Illuminated Channel Letters: <br />a. Face-lit channel letter backers must be a minimum <br />of .080" thick aluminum or greater as required <br />by engineering. <br />b. Face-lit channel letters mounted on the fi rst or second <br />story of a building shall be trimless. <br />c. Face-lit channel letters installed on the third fl oor or <br />higher of a building may use a low-profi le trim cap. <br />8. Low profi le Illuminated Channel Letters: <br />a. Letters fabricated out of white translucent acrylic <br />(usually 30 to 40mm thick) with a routed cavity <br />in the back of each letter for LED's illumination <br />to be installed. These letters typically have an <br />aluminum backer. <br />b. Letters may be face, side, or back-lit or any <br />combination of the three based upon the Design <br />Intent Drawings. <br />c. Letters must be evenly illuminated throughout the <br />acrylic without hotspots or shadows. <br />J. Drain holes: <br />1. Provide drain holes as needed to prevent accumulation of <br />water within signs. <br />2. Holes must be inconspicuous and located such that <br />drainage does not occur onto signs, bases, or other surfaces <br />subject to staining. <br />3. Provide internal system of baffl es to prevent “light leaks” <br />through drain holes of illuminated signs. <br />4. Use color-coordinated stainless steel bug mesh screen over <br />drain holes or vents. <br />K. Painting: <br />1. Sign panels shall be appropriately pre-drilled/pre-cut before <br />priming and painting or coating. <br />2. Metal surfaces are to be painted per the most recent <br />Matthews Paint or Akzo Nobel product bulletins. <br />3. Paint preparation of all metal surfaces of the sign to include <br />removal of all scratches and imperfections, sanding and <br />chemical etching. <br />4. Substrate cleaning, preparation, paint application and paint <br />thickness to be in strict compliance with Matthews Paint <br />or Akzo Nobel published recommendations and product <br />bulletins. <br />5. Aluminum and Steel surfaces to be properly covered with <br />a primer. <br />6. Acceleration of the drying process and use of accelerants are <br />not allowed. <br />7. All paint and powder coat fi nishes to be a satin fi nish unless <br />otherwise noted in the Design Intent Drawings. <br />8. All painted surfaces to have a clearcoat fi nish to add UV <br />protection and protection from the elements. <br />9. Finished work shall be uniform, crisp, accurate, visibly <br />free from fl ow lines, streaks, bleeding, blisters, cracking, <br />peeling or other imperfections, without over spray, or <br />rounded corners. <br />10. Mask & Spray: All masking shall be executed with a digitally <br />cut vinyl mask which has an adhesive specifi cally designed <br />for clean removal when promptly removed after painting <br />and curing cycles. <br />a. No hand-cut masks shall be used. <br />b. Finished edges of masked graphics or copy shall be <br />true, clean, and visibly free from overspray. <br />L. Clear Coat: <br />1. A compatible protective UV/ Anti-Graffi ti Clearcoat shall be <br />applied to all painted surfaces. Fabricator to verify all product <br />warranties and compatibility with applied to surfaces. <br />M. Silk-screen, digital printing, and vinyl copy: <br />1. All letterforms, symbols or graphics shall be reproduced <br />either by photographic or computer-generated means. <br />2. Cutting shall be done such that edges and corners of <br />fi nished letterforms will be straight, sharp and true. <br />3. Letterforms with nicked, cut, ragged, rounded corners, and <br />similar disfi gurements will not be acceptable. <br />4. Copy is to match the sheen of the copy panel background <br />(satin). <br />5. Surface of graphics shall be uniform in color fi nish, and free <br />from striping, pinholes, and other imperfections. <br />6. Images shall be uniform in color and ink thickness. <br />7. Use only weather-resistant coating materials that are <br />compatible with substrates. <br />8. Silk-screened images shall be executed with photo- <br />processed screens prepared from original electronic art. <br />9. Silk-screening shall be highest quality, with sharp lines and <br />no sawtooths or uneven ink coverage.
